Early Life and Education

Born and raised in Detroit, Michigan, Geoffrey A. Landis showed an early affinity for science, particularly astronomy, and a passion for reading. His educational path led him from local schools to the prestigious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T) and later, Brown University.

Influences and Passions

Landis was profoundly influenced by science fiction icons such as Isaac Asimov, Arthur C. Clarke, and Robert A. Heinlein. These authors ignited his imagination and inspired his dual career path in science and literature.

Contributions to Aerospace Engineering

NASA Achievements

Landis's tenure at NASA includes pivotal roles in the Mars Pathfinder mission and the Mars Exploration Rovers, enhancing our strategies for planetary exploration. His expertise in solar power and energy systems has been crucial to these projects.

Innovations in Technology

Beyond Mars, Landis has investigated interstellar propulsion systems and solar power applications for space missions, resulting in numerous scientific papers and patents.

Literary Career

Acclaimed Science Fiction Author

Parallel to his engineering career, Landis has thrived as a science fiction writer. His works, known for their scientific precision and imaginative depth, have earned him prestigious awards such as the Nebula Award, Hugo Awards, and the Locus Award.

Publications

His notable publications, including "Mars Crossing" and "Impact Parameter," blend engaging narratives with educational elements, appealing to a broad audience of readers.

Personal Life

Geoffrey A. Landis is married to Mary A. Turzillo, an acclaimed science fiction writer. Their shared interests have fostered a supportive and creative partnership.

Interests Beyond Work

Landis is also passionate about poetry, having published a collection titled "Iron Angels" in 2009. His diverse interests continue to influence his professional output and personal life.

Recognition and Achievements

Landis's dual careers have garnered him numerous accolades, including the Theodore Sturgeon Award and the AIAA Abe M. Zarem Educator Award. He holds nine patents and has authored over 300 scientific papers.
